Huntington presents a compact, pedestrian-friendly community with many everyday necessities conveniently nearby. The area benefits from easy access to the Cold Spring Harbor railway station on the Port Jefferson Branch, complemented by several nearby bus lines. Residents find grocery stores and pharmacies within a short trip, while a selection of local restaurants adds convenience. The community is known for its calm and quiet streets, creating a peaceful environment. Housing primarily consists of charming single detached homes often featuring three or more bedrooms, with construction dating mostly prior to 1960. Public and private elementary schools serve the neighborhood well.

Huntington offers a slower-paced environment. Most areas in Huntington are very quiet, as there isn't a lot of street noise or city clamor.

Highlights of Huntington Hamlet

Parks, schools, dining, and what makes this neighborhood special

🌳 Heckscher Park

Located right on Prime Avenue, Heckscher Park serves as the green heart of Huntington Hamlet, featuring beautiful walking paths, a central pond, and year-round cultural events including art festivals and concerts that draw the community together.

🏫 Huntington High School

Situated on Oakwood Road, Huntington High School is an anchor for local families, known for its robust academic and athletic programs, as well as its strong sense of school spirit and active involvement in the greater Huntington community.

🍽️ New York Avenue Restaurant Row

Running through the center of Huntington Hamlet, New York Avenue bursts with an eclectic mix of independent restaurants, cafes, and bakeries, making it a key spot for food lovers seeking everything from classic Italian to gourmet desserts.

🛒 Walt Whitman Shops

This bustling shopping center on Route 110 is a go-to destination for residents of Huntington Hamlet, offering a diverse range of high-end retailers, national brands, and convenient dining options, all within a short drive east of the main neighborhood.

🚴 Huntington Greenway Trail

A local favorite for walkers and cyclists, the Huntington Greenway Trail meanders from Oakwood Road to Park Avenue, providing safe, scenic connectivity between the core of the hamlet and adjacent parks, perfect for daily exercise or a leisurely family outing.
